About this property

Garden and Loft Apartment - Mansion Buxton

Garden & Loft Apartment is a beautiful fully self-contained 2 storey townhouse style apartment. The apartment offers 3 bedrooms with a king bed in the master bedroom, a queen bed and single bed in the 2nd bedroom and 2 king single beds in the upstairs 'loft' bedroom. There is a full kitchen with dishwasher and large dining table and a separate living room with LCD TV/DVD/CD and French doors opening out to the sweeping lawns of Buxton Manor where we have 1/2 an acre of gardens, 2 wood fire BBQs, outdoor table and chairs and umbrellas. The apartment is furnished with glorious Australian antiques. Buxton Manor offers a separate laundry adjoining the apartment with a washing machine and dryer as well as another toilet.


Guest Access

The Buxton Manor is a stunning 1909 restored large Mansion built in the William Morris ‘Arts & Craft' theme of decorative red brick with steep sloping roof lines. It houses our best collection of Australian antiques and memorabilia and features open log fires, polished spruce floors, decorative fireplaces, marbleized ceilings, rag rolled faux paint finishes, ornate ceiling roses, gilt mirrors and sumptuous antique beds. Buxton Manor features 4 separate very large apartments and 1 spa cottage, all of which offer private entrances, bathrooms, fully equipped kitchens, unique living areas and valuable rare furnishings. Buxton Manor is surrounded by half an acre of manicured, welcoming gardens with masses of old fashioned scented roses, cottage flowers and sweeping lawns. It has been heritage listed by the State government and completely restored, and features half an acre of manicured gardens with outdoor designer furniture, umbrella's and 2 wood fire BBQs.
